What is RNG?

A Random Number Generator is a computational algorithm designed to produce sequences of numbers that lack any predictable pattern. In online color prediction games, these numbers are mapped to different colors or outcomes. For example, if a game offers red, green, and blue as possible outcomes, the RNG generates a number that corresponds to one of these colors. The process is instantaneous and independent of previous results, ensuring that each round is unique. RNG is not influenced by player behavior or external factors, making it a reliable tool for maintaining fairness.

How RNG Generates Outcomes

The process of RNG generation involves complex mathematical algorithms. Most online platforms use pseudo-random number generators, which rely on seed values to produce sequences that appear random. While pseudo-random generators are deterministic, they are designed to be unpredictable enough for gaming purposes. Advanced platforms may use hardware-based RNGs, which rely on physical processes such as electrical noise to generate truly random numbers. Regardless of the method, the generated numbers are mapped to game outcomes, ensuring that each round is independent and unbiased.

Ensuring Fairness and Transparency

To maintain trust, platforms often subject their RNG systems to independent audits. Third-party agencies test the algorithms to verify that outcomes are genuinely random and not manipulated. Certification from these agencies reassures players that the games are fair. Transparency is further enhanced when platforms publish audit reports or explain their RNG mechanisms to users. By demonstrating compliance with industry standards, platforms build credibility and encourage responsible participation.

Misconceptions About RNG

Many players mistakenly believe that RNG outcomes can be predicted or influenced. Some rely on perceived patterns, assuming that a certain color is “due” after a sequence of others. This belief stems from cognitive biases such as the gambler’s fallacy. In reality, RNG ensures that each round is independent, meaning that no outcome is more likely than another based on past results. Understanding this principle helps players approach the games with realistic expectations, treating them as entertainment rather than a guaranteed source of profit.
